Barcelona Crashes Out Of Copa Del Rey In Round Of 16 For First Time In A Decade After Bilbao Brilliance

Barcelona has crashed out of the Copa del Rey in the Round of 16 for the first time in 12 years after Athletic Bilbao won in extra time 3-2 on Thursday. This was revenge for Athletic after losing in the final to Barcelona 4-0 last season.

The game got off to a thrilling start when rising star Nico Williams burned Jordi Alba down the right wing before sending in a dangerous cross. Iker Muniain picked up Nico’s ball to score a beautiful goal to send San Mamés wild.

Jackass Of The Day Goes To Whoever Brought A Pole To Seville Derby And Threw It At A Player

A Spanish Cup clash between rivals Sevilla and Real Betis was abandoned on Saturday after Sevilla player Joan Jordan was struck in the head by an object thrown from the stands.

Video replays showed a pole-shaped object hitting Jordan on the head moments after Nabil Fekir had equalized for hosts Betis to draw the last 16 tie level at 1-1 at the Estadio Benito Villamarin.

Six-Part Docuseries ‘El Presidente’ Examines Ronaldo’s Life As Valladolid Owner

On May 20, streaming platform DAZN will globally launch the six-part documentary series El Presidente, which goes behind the scenes of Ronaldo’s current life as president of LaLiga club Real Valladolid. 

Back in September of 2018, the Brazilian legend purchased a 51 percent stake in the club for $35 million. He now owns 82 percent of the 92-year-old club that plays in front of over 27,000 at the Estadio José Zorrilla. 

Barça President Makes Bold Prediction On Lionel Messi’s Future

SEVILLE - Barcelona president Joan Laporta said he was very confident Lionel Messi would choose to stay at the club after the Argentine delivered a vintage performance in Saturday's 4-0 win over Athletic Bilbao in the Copa del Rey final.

Messi scored a sensational individual goal midway through the second half after strikes from Antoine Griezmann and Frenkie de Jong had put the Catalans in charge.

Sergiño Dest Becomes First American To Win Copa Del Rey (And Look At That Messi Hug)

Sergiño Dest became the first U.S. international to start a Copa del Rey final and 90 minutes later became the first to lift the trophy as he helped Barcelona beat Athletic Bilbao 4-0 on Saturday at Estadio Olímpico de la Cartuja in Seville.

Real Sociedad Ends Epic Trophy Drought With 2020 Copa Del Rey Title

SEVILLE, Spain — Real Sociedad beat local rivals Athletic Bilbao 1-0 in the rescheduled 2020 Copa del Rey final on Saturday to get their hands on a major trophy for the first time since 1987.

Captain Mikel Oyarzabal netted the winner by sending keeper Unai Simon the wrong way from the penalty spot in the 63rd minute after strike partner Portu was felled in the area by Athletic defender Inigo Martinez.
